WRONG DESCRIPTION.
TRADE REPRESENTATIVE FIXED. ißy Tplograph.—rrpss Association.! WELLINGTON, this day. In the Magistrate's Court to-day R. E. Turton, representative for .1. K. Phillips and Co., England, \va3 fined £23 for delivering a. document to tie Customs Department erroneously stating certain goods to he "wholly or partially made in the United Kingdom.'' whereas they were, wholly manufactured in Fiance. The charge referred to a con signment of beads, which, as they were made in France, were liable to heavier duty. Counsel said similar mistakes had been made on previous occasions.
